Bournemouth Uni finds new home at Lakeside

Bournemouth University has agreed a deal to create a new teaching base for its midwifery courses at Portsmouth’s Lakeside North Harbour development.

The university will take more than 6,200 sq ft of office space on the five-building campus.

Simon Bateman, asset manager at Lakeside North Harbour, said: “For the students and staff, who may split their time between Lakeside and the nearby QA Hospital, as well as Isle of Wight and Hampshire Hospitals, the campus’ flexible, thriving and supportive work environment will surely match their needs perfectly and hope they thoroughly enjoy what we have to offer.” 

Dr Catherine Angell, associate professor and head of the Department For Midwifery and Health Sciences at Bournemouth University, said: “We feel that Lakeside North Harbour is an ideal location for our midwifery students in Portsmouth to be based. The site has a strong ‘campus atmosphere’ with coffee shops, plenty of green space and a shuttle bus service into the nearby city centre, making for an inviting place to study.”

Avison Young is letting agent at Lakeside North Harbour.
